Transaction 966581baf1c85432fc1807d6a4c33e9ea7c09693e2cc5bf45730a421defca4fd
1 Input
1 Output
-
966581baf1c85432fc1807d6a4c33e9ea7c09693e2cc5bf45730a421defca4fd:0
- value
- 20420
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b99d22f6fab803bd17d6b3086f27ce2bd867666 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13WwWrSSxnu3duEyfWS3RWLyyzZoM6tNMW